So, I also tried the Ryet Aircode, RT03 and RT06s with 3D-printed cushioning. The Aircode and RT06 weren't for me in terms of fit; I rode the RT03 (style clone of Specialized Romin EVO Pro) for about three months. In general, all three are very good quality, and I would recommend them. For a while, I thought I needed a 3D-printed cushion. And it is comfortable indeed, but especially on longer rides, the 3D-printed top layer has some disadvantages. Namely, your bib tends to stick more to the saddle, which a) puts more stress on the bib fabric and b) creates more rubbing between the bib and your skin.
